Why Backing Up Travel Photos Matters: The 321 Backup Rule

If your photos exist in only one place, they do not truly exist yet. A single SD card can fail from static electricity, water, physical damage, or simple file corruption with zero warning. I have seen cards that worked perfectly one day and read as empty the next, with no recovery possible.

Professional photographers follow something called the 321 backup rule, and you should too. The rule is simple: keep three copies of your photos, on two different types of storage, with at least one copy stored in a different physical location.

For travel photography, this usually breaks down like this. Copy one stays on your original memory card inside the camera. Copy two lives on your portable SSD that you carry in your bag. Copy three can be a second SD card if your camera has dual slots, or a cloud upload when you reach wifi at your hotel.

The key insight is that keeping all copies in the same bag defeats the purpose. If your bag gets stolen or falls in a river, every copy dies together. Split your backups between your daypack, your main luggage, and your pocket whenever possible.

What You Need: The Minimal Gear Setup

The beauty of this method is how little gear it requires. Here is the complete list of what you need to back up photos on the road without a laptop:

  • A smartphone or tablet running iOS 13+ or Android with USB OTG support. This is your file management hub. Most phones from the last several years work perfectly.

  • A USB-C hub with a built-in SD card reader. Look for one with USB-C Power Delivery passthrough so you can charge your phone while transferring files. Hubs with UHS-II card readers will give you faster transfer speeds.

  • A portable SSD formatted to ExFAT. Popular options include the Samsung T7, SanDisk Extreme Portable, and Crucial X6. Any 1TB or larger drive gives you plenty of room for a multi-week trip of RAW files.

  • A power bank rated for at least 18W output with Power Delivery. This powers the hub and SSD during transfer, since phones cannot supply enough juice on their own.

  • Your camera’s SD cards. Keep at least two or three cards so you can rotate them and maintain redundancy.

That is the entire kit. It weighs under a pound total and takes up less space than a paperback book. Compare that to lugging a laptop, charger, and external drive through airports and up mountain trails.

One note on the SSD choice: avoid older spinning hard drives (HDDs). They are slower, more fragile, and more sensitive to movement during transfers. Portable SSDs have no moving parts, survive drops better, and transfer files significantly faster.

How to Back Up Travel Photos on the Road Without a Laptop: Step-by-Step

This is the core process. Once you do it two or three times, it becomes second nature and takes about ten minutes per SD card. The steps below work for both iPhone and Android, with minor differences noted where they matter.

Step 1: Connect the USB-C hub to your power bank. Plug the hub’s USB-C input into your power bank using a Power Delivery cable. This keeps the hub and connected devices drawing power from the bank instead of your phone battery. Without this step, your phone will drain fast and may throttle the transfer.

Step 2: Plug your phone into the hub. Connect your phone to the hub’s USB-C output (or use a USB-C to Lightning adapter for older iPhones). Your phone should recognize the connected devices within a few seconds.

Step 3: Insert your SD card into the hub’s card reader. The card should click into place gently. Do not force it. If your camera uses CFexpress cards instead of SD, you will need a hub with a CFexpress slot or a dedicated CFexpress reader.

Step 4: Connect your portable SSD to the hub. Use a USB-C cable to plug the SSD into one of the hub’s USB ports. Wait for your phone to recognize the drive. On iPhone, the Files app will show it under Locations. On Android, it appears in the Files app or your file manager of choice.

Step 5: Open your phone’s file manager app. On iPhone, use the built-in Files app. On Android, Google Files or Solid Explorer both work well. You should see both the SD card and the SSD listed as available storage locations.

Step 6: Create a destination folder on the SSD. Go to your SSD in the file manager and create a folder for the current trip and date. For example: “Iceland-2026 / Day-06 / Card-01.” Consistent naming now saves you hours of confusion later when you are sorting through thousands of files at home.

Step 7: Select all files on the SD card and copy them to the SSD folder. On iPhone, tap Select, choose all, tap Copy, then open your SSD folder and tap Paste. On Android, long-press to select, then copy and paste. For large batches, the transfer will show a progress indicator.

Step 8: Wait for the transfer to complete, then verify. Do not disconnect anything until the progress bar finishes completely. Transfer speeds average about 1GB per minute with a good SSD, so a full 64GB card takes roughly an hour. A 128GB card takes about two hours. Plan your transfers for downtime at your hotel or during a long transit.

Step 9: Safely eject both devices. Use your phone’s eject option for the SD card and SSD before physically unplugging anything. This prevents file corruption from incomplete writes. We will cover the exact verification steps in detail later in this guide.

Why ExFAT Format Matters (And How to Check It)

ExFAT is the single most important technical detail in this entire process. If your SSD is not formatted to ExFAT, your phone will likely refuse to write to it, or worse, it will appear to work and then corrupt your files silently.

ExFAT is a file system designed specifically for cross-platform compatibility. Windows, Mac, iOS, and Android can all read and write to ExFAT drives without any special software. Older formats like NTFS are read-only on Mac and many phones. FAT32 works everywhere but has a crippling 4GB file size limit, which means a single high-resolution video or a burst of RAW files could fail mid-transfer.

To check your SSD’s format on a Mac, connect the drive and open Disk Utility. Click on the drive name and look at the format field in the details panel. On Windows, right-click the drive in File Explorer, select Properties, and check the File system line.

If your drive is not ExFAT, you will need to reformat it before your trip. Do this at home where you have a computer. Reformatting erases everything on the drive, so back up any existing data first. On Mac, use Disk Utility and select ExFAT from the format dropdown. On Windows, right-click the drive, select Format, and choose ExFAT.

Format your SSD before you leave home. Trying to troubleshoot format issues from a hostel bed with no laptop is a headache you want to avoid entirely.

Power Requirements and Solutions

The most common question our team gets is why the transfer fails or runs painfully slow. The answer is almost always power. A portable SSD and a USB hub together draw more current than a phone can provide through its charging port.

Without external power, your phone tries to power both the card reader and the SSD from its own battery. This causes three problems. The phone battery drains rapidly, the SSD may throttle to slower speeds to reduce power draw, and in some cases the transfer will stall or fail entirely when the phone cuts power to protect itself.

The solution is a USB-C hub with Power Delivery passthrough. This feature lets you connect a power bank to the hub, which then powers the connected devices while simultaneously passing data through to your phone. The power bank handles the heavy lifting, and your phone battery stays untouched.

For the power bank itself, look for one rated for at least 18W output with USB-C Power Delivery. A 10,000mAh bank can handle several full SD card transfers before needing a recharge. If you are on an extended trip with limited charging opportunities, consider a 20,000mAh bank to give yourself a comfortable buffer.

I always start transfers with a fully charged power bank and phone. Mid-transfer battery death is one of the most common causes of corrupted files, and it is completely avoidable with a little planning.

Dual Card Slot Strategy for Redundancy

If your camera has dual card slots, you have a powerful redundancy tool built right in. Many photographers do not use dual slots to their full potential because they set both cards to overflow mode, which means the second card only starts recording when the first fills up. That gives you zero redundancy.

Instead, set your camera to write every photo to both cards simultaneously. This is called backup mode or mirror mode depending on your camera brand. Every shot gets written to card one and card two at the same time, giving you an instant duplicate of every frame.

With this setup, your backup workflow becomes a three-copy system. Copy one is on your primary SD card. Copy two is on your mirrored SD card. Copy three is on your portable SSD after your nightly transfer. Even if one card fails completely, you have two other copies of everything.

The extra layer of security is keeping your two camera cards in different physical places. Store one card in your camera and the other in your hotel safe or a separate bag pocket. If your camera bag gets lost or stolen, the second card with identical files survives in a different location.

This strategy costs nothing extra if you already own a dual-slot camera. You just need a second card of the same capacity and a settings change that takes thirty seconds.

File Organization Tips for the Field

Good file organization on the road saves you hours of sorting when you get home. The system I use is simple, consistent, and works whether you are on a weekend trip or a three-month expedition.

Create a main folder for each trip on your SSD before you leave. Inside that folder, create subfolders for each day of the trip, named by date. When you transfer each night, copy the full contents of the card into that day’s folder. Do not rename individual files during transfer, as this slows the process and risks errors.

For RAW versus JPEG handling, the good news is that file managers copy both formats identically. The smartphone method handles RAW files just fine. The common myth that phones cannot process RAW files is misleading. Your phone is not editing the files, it is simply copying them byte for byte. RAW files like CR3, NEF, and ARW transfer without any issues.

Video files work the same way, but they are much larger. A single 4K video clip can be several gigabytes. If you shoot a lot of video, budget extra SSD space and transfer time. A card full of video can take two to three times longer to back up than a card full of stills.

What happens when your SSD fills up mid-trip? This is a scenario most guides skip. The simplest solution is to carry a second SSD as a backup drive. When the first fills, swap it out and continue. Alternatively, if you have wifi access, you can upload your best selects to a cloud service to free space before continuing to shoot.

Never delete files from your SD card to free space until you have verified the backup transfer completed successfully. Formatting a card before confirming the backup is the most common way travelers lose photos permanently.

How to Verify Your Transfer Worked (And Safely Eject)

Verifying that your files copied correctly is the step most travelers skip, and it is the step that matters most. A transfer that looks complete can still have missing or corrupted files if the connection was interrupted.

The quickest verification method is to compare file counts. Before transferring, note how many files are on your SD card. After transferring, check that the destination folder on your SSD contains the same number of files. If the counts match, you have a strong indication the transfer was complete.

For a deeper check, compare the total file size. Select all files on the SD card and note the combined size. Then select all files in the destination folder and compare. The sizes should match exactly or differ by only a few bytes due to file system overhead.

If you want to be thorough, open a few random RAW or JPEG files from the SSD copy on your phone. If they display correctly, the files are intact. A corrupted file will either fail to open or show visual glitches like banding and color shifts.

Once you have verified the transfer, safely eject the devices. On iPhone, tap the eject icon next to the SD card and SSD names in the Files app under Locations. On Android, use the unmount or eject option in your file manager. Wait a few seconds after ejecting before physically unplugging cables.

Never pull the SD card or SSD out while a transfer is in progress, even if the progress bar appears stuck. Give it time, or cancel the transfer through the app first. Force-disconnecting during a write operation is a leading cause of file corruption on both the source card and the destination drive.

Troubleshooting Common Backup Issues

Even with the right gear, things occasionally go wrong. Here are the most common issues and how to fix them in the field.

The SSD does not appear in your file manager. First, check that the SSD is receiving power through the hub. Try unplugging and reconnecting the drive. If it still does not appear, the drive may not be ExFAT formatted. Some phones also struggle with certain SSD models, so test your specific combination before your trip.

Transfer speeds are painfully slow. This usually points to a power issue. Make sure your power bank is connected and delivering Power Delivery to the hub. Slow speeds can also come from using a UHS-I card reader instead of UHS-II, or from a low-quality USB cable. Use the cable that came with your SSD rather than a random one from your bag.

The transfer stops partway through. A stalled transfer often means the phone or power bank ran low on battery. Check your charge levels and start again. If the transfer consistently fails at the same file, that specific file may be corrupted on the SD card. Try transferring everything except that file, then attempt the problem file separately.

Your file manager app crashes during transfer. This happens most often with very large batches of files. Try breaking the transfer into smaller chunks of a few hundred files at a time. On Android, switching to a different file manager app can resolve persistent crashes. Solid Explorer and FX File Explorer are reliable alternatives to the default options.

The SD card is not recognized. Remove and reinsert the card. Check for dust or debris in the card reader slot. If the card works in your camera but not the hub, the card reader may be incompatible with that card type. Some UHS-II cards require a matching UHS-II reader to function properly.

FAQs

How do I backup photos while traveling without computer internet?

Use a USB-C hub with a built-in SD card reader connected to your smartphone and a portable SSD. Plug in a power bank for delivery, insert your camera’s SD card, connect the SSD, and use your phone’s Files app to copy photos directly from card to drive. No internet connection is needed for this process.

Can you transfer pictures from camera directly to portable hard drive without computer?

Not directly from camera to drive alone, but you can use your smartphone as the bridge. Connect a USB-C hub with card reader to your phone, insert the SD card and the SSD, then copy files using your phone’s file manager. The phone manages the transfer between the two devices.

What is the 321 backup rule for photos?

The 321 rule means keeping three copies of your photos, on two different types of storage media, with at least one copy stored in a different physical location. For travel, this typically means one copy on your camera’s SD card, one on your portable SSD, and one on a second card or in cloud storage.

How long does it take to backup an SD card to a portable SSD?

With a modern portable SSD and a powered USB-C hub, transfer speeds average about 1GB per minute. A full 64GB card takes roughly one hour, and a 128GB card takes about two hours. Video-heavy cards may take longer due to larger individual file sizes.

Do I need ExFAT format for my backup SSD?

Yes, ExFAT is strongly recommended. It is the only format that offers full read and write compatibility across iOS, Android, Mac, and Windows without file size limits. FAT32 has a 4GB file limit, and NTFS is read-only on many phones and Macs.

Can I backup RAW files using the smartphone method?

Yes, RAW files transfer without issues. Your phone is copying the files, not editing them, so formats like CR3, NEF, ARW, and DNG move byte for byte just like JPEGs. The phone does not need to process or render the RAW data during transfer.
